Susan Hickenbottom is a Neurologist and a Palliative Medicine provider in Detroit, Michigan. Her top areas of expertise are Stroke, Transient Ischemic Attack (TIA), Seizures, and Primary Progressive Aphasia. Dr. Hickenbottom is currently accepting new patients.

Her clinical research consists of co-authoring 1 peer reviewed article and participating in 1 clinical trial.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.

Areas of Expertise

MediFind evaluates expertise by pulling from factors such as number of articles a doctor has published in medical journals, participation in clinical trials, speaking at industry conferences, prescribing and referral patterns, and strength of connections with other experts in their field.
